Handover — Feedwright validator (from outgoing to incoming on-call). Support team: the Feedwright podcast feed validator runs on the Tarnmill cluster and rechecks every registered feed hourly. Most escalations are malformed enclosure tags; the validator flags them but does not block publishing, so reassure users accordingly. The admin dashboard auto-locks after 30 idle minutes. Nightly reports go to the shared review folder. If the dashboard session store resets and nobody can log in, unlock it with the recovery passphrase noted below.

vault phrase of bafop-kahop = sormir-frador

Handover note — pool car keys

Hi Tomasz, as discussed, the key cabinet for the pool cars now lives in the back corridor at Lindqvist House, beside the cleaning store. New starters should always sign the paper log before taking a fob, note the mileage on return, and hang keys on the numbered hooks only — never leave them on the shelf. The cabinet lock was rekeyed last month. The code you'll need for the corridor door is below.

door code, yagap-bahof: bdg-O-05

Fan-out backpressure for the Quillet notifier: when the queue depth crosses the soft limit, the dispatcher sheds low-priority pushes and batches the rest at 500ms intervals. Reviewer should confirm the shed counter is exported and that retries respect the jitter window. Once merged, the release artifact gets re-signed by the pipeline, which expects the deploy key shown below.

deploy key for bawep-yawif: bky6_GQhaSt

## Runbook: PortionWise Scaling Calculator

If scaled quantities come back null, the unit-conversion cache is stale. Flush it via the admin endpoint, then restart the worker pool. Conversion factors live in the `units_ref` table; never edit them in prod without a ticket. To inspect the table directly, connect using the string below.

replica DSN, kajep-yahag: mssql://praok_svc:iF@db-8d68.plorvaio.local:5432/eliion